Introduction

The idea of holding the International Conference on Design and Analysis of Protective Structures against Impact/Impulsive/Shock Loads was conceived in 2003 by the three founding institutes of the conference series, namely, National Defense Academy, Japan, Pennsylvania State University, USA and Nanyang Technological University, Singapore. The first conference was organized by the National Defense Academy, Japan and held in Tokyo, Japan, on 15-19 December, 2003 with the theme "State-of-the-art in Protective Technology for Structure Construction". The second conference organized by the Defence Science and Technology Agency, Singapore and Nanyang Technological University, Singapore was held in Singapore on 13-15 November 2006 with the theme "Advances in Protective Technology". The third conference was also organized by the same institutions on 10-12 May 2010 in Singapore. The fourth conference was organized by Agency for Defense Development and the Korea Institute of Military Science and Technology on 19-22 June 2012 in Jeju, Korea. The organizing committee takes great pleasure in inviting you to the Fifth International Conference on Design and Analysis of Protective Structures (DAPS2015), which will be held on 19-21 May 2015 at Furama Riverfront Hotel, Singapore.
